What to do in a Bicycle Crash

There are a few things you need to know to protect your legal rights in a bike crash. If you are in a crash with a car, do not leave the scene without:

Even in cases where cyclists are badly hurt, the police have not always identified the vehicle or driver involved. The ambulance personnel will not include this information in their report – you must make sure the information gets recorded by the police. If it is a hit and run, you need to file a police report as soon as you are able.
